Cetus hackers have stolen over $200 million in funds and are now converting them into USDC

2025-05-22 11:31

Odaily Planet Daily reported that according to the monitoring of On Chain Lens, Cetus Protocol, a liquidity provider for DEX and SUI, has been hacked. The attacker has taken control of all mining pools denominated in SUI and has stolen over $200 million in funds. They have now begun to convert the stolen funds into USDC.
